Keeping pipes protected through the final freezing temperatures

As Houston faces its last night of freezing temperatures, residents are urged to take precautions to protect their plumbing. Plumber Hector Morales shares essential tips, such as wrapping pipes with insulation and maintaining water flow, to prevent them from bursting. With icy roads delaying repair services, these preventive measures are crucial to avoid costly damage until the weather warms up.
